Akram Wah
Akram Wah is a canal in Sindh, Pakistan. Akram Wah is situated nearby to the locality Goth Bhaledīno, as well as near Oammurdin.Places in the Area
Nearby places include Rajo Nizamani and Saeedpur.

Saeedpur
Village
Saidpur, aka Goth Saidpur, is a village and deh in Bulri Shah Karim taluka of Tando Muhammad Khan District, Sindh. As of 2017, it has a population of 1,994, in 365 households. Saeedpur is situated 9 km southwest of Akram Wah.
